Black Cats

Hello Everyone, I have just registered on this site to pass some information on if anyone is interested. At the moment the only Jaguars that are still being run and taxyied are at RAF Cranwell, at the moment they are one by one being put into paint. When they come out they will all be gloss black with the Sqn markings from their last Sqn's. The first one will be out in a week or so and I can try to keep you up to date of it's progress if anyone is interested and may want to get some photos when it gets towed back to the hangar. Either way I think they will look great in black. Hope their is some interest for these old cats.
